#609443 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#609443 is composed of 37.6% red, 58% green and 26.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 35.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 54.7% yellow and 42% black. It has a hue angle of 98.5 degrees, a saturation of 37.7% and a lightness of 42.2%. #609443 color hex could be obtained by blending #c0ff86 with #002900. Closest websafe color is: #669933.

● #609443 color description : Dark moderate green.
The hexadecimal color #609443 has RGB values of R:96, G:148, B:67 and CMYK values of C:0.35, M:0, Y:0.55,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 6329411.
